INFORMATION SPECIFIC TO XSHOOTER           [?]
The following keys are used to define a STANDARD XSHOOTER setup:

ins.opti2.name (= IFU/SLOT)
ins.opti3/4/5.name (= slit width for different arms)
det.win1.binx/y (= binning along x/y axis; UVB and VIS only)
det.read.clock (= readout mode; UVB and VIS only)
det.dit (= exposure time, NIR only)
